26 /* The extra casts in the following macros work around compiler bugs,
27 e.g., in Cray C 5.0.3.0. */
28
29 /* True if the arithmetic type T is an integer type. bool counts as
30 an integer. */
31 # define TYPE_IS_INTEGER(t) ((t) 1.5 == 1)
32
33 /* True if negative values of the signed integer type T use two's
34 complement, ones' complement, or signed magnitude representation,
35 respectively. Much GNU code assumes two's complement, but some
36 people like to be portable to all possible C hosts. */
37 # define TYPE_TWOS_COMPLEMENT(t) ((t) ~ (t) 0 == (t) -1)
38 # define TYPE_ONES_COMPLEMENT(t) ((t) ~ (t) 0 == 0)
39 # define TYPE_SIGNED_MAGNITUDE(t) ((t) ~ (t) 0 < (t) -1)
40
41 /* True if the arithmetic type T is signed. */
42 # define TYPE_SIGNED(t) (! ((t) 0 < (t) -1))
43
44 /* The maximum and minimum values for the integer type T. These
45 macros have undefined behavior if T is signed and has padding bits.
46 If this is a problem for you, please let us know how to fix it for
47 your host. */
48 # define TYPE_MINIMUM(t) \
49 ((t) (! TYPE_SIGNED (t) \
50 ? (t) 0 \
51 : TYPE_SIGNED_MAGNITUDE (t) \
52 ? ~ (t) 0 \
53 : ~ (t) 0 << (sizeof (t) * CHAR_BIT - 1)))
54 # define TYPE_MAXIMUM(t) \
55 ((t) (! TYPE_SIGNED (t) \
56 ? (t) -1 \
57 : ~ (~ (t) 0 << (sizeof (t) * CHAR_BIT - 1))))
58
59 /* Return zero if T can be determined to be an unsigned type.
60 Otherwise, return 1.
61 When compiling with GCC, INT_STRLEN_BOUND uses this macro to obtain a
62 tighter bound. Otherwise, it overestimates the true bound by one byte
63 when applied to unsigned types of size 2, 4, 16, ... bytes.
64 The symbol signed_type_or_expr__ is private to this header file. */
65 # if __GNUC__ >= 2
66 # define signed_type_or_expr__(t) TYPE_SIGNED (__typeof__ (t))
67 # else
68 # define signed_type_or_expr__(t) 1
69 # endif
70
71 /* Bound on length of the string representing an integer type or expression T.
72 Subtract 1 for the sign bit if T is signed; log10 (2.0) < 146/485;
73 add 1 for integer division truncation; add 1 more for a minus sign
74 if needed. */
75 # define INT_STRLEN_BOUND(t) \
76 ((sizeof (t) * CHAR_BIT - signed_type_or_expr__ (t)) * 146 / 485 \
77 + signed_type_or_expr__ (t) + 1)
78
79 /* Bound on buffer size needed to represent an integer type or expression T,
80 including the terminating null. */
81 # define INT_BUFSIZE_BOUND(t) (INT_STRLEN_BOUND (t) + 1)
